Chapter 167: Chapter 167: Divine Assist

"Back in the day, to marry your Aunt Chang, I had to fetch water and chop firewood for her family for three or four years before my old father-in-law finally agreed."

The supervisor shared his experience with Tang Yuanxiao. "You’re right to think that way. That’s how a man should be."

A flicker of a smile crossed Tang Yuanxiao’s eyes as he nodded firmly. "I know."

"I was a little worried about your state of mind, afraid you weren’t holding up, but it seems I don’t need to be."

The supervisor paused. "What have you decided about that advanced training course I mentioned? If you’re going to do it, you need to start preparing."

The supervisor had a gut feeling that Tang Yuanxiao would agree.

’Considering Su Li is a university student, Tang Yuanxiao has to agree, right?’

The supervisor thought this as he looked at Tang Yuanxiao, who remained silent for a moment before, as expected, nodding.

"I’ll sign up. I won’t waste this opportunity."

"Good." The supervisor had just nodded when he heard Tang Yuanxiao continue.

"And I’m also signing up for the training program in six months."

Hearing this, the smile on the supervisor’s face froze. "What did you say? You want to participate?"

"Yes," Tang Yuanxiao nodded.

The supervisor immediately shook his head. "No."

Why didn’t he agree? Because it was grueling.

Tang Yuanxiao met the requirements in terms of ability, but the supervisor didn’t want him to go.

Yes, colleagues who returned from the training program underwent a complete metamorphosis, becoming the true tip of the spear—nearly invincible. Their careers would also be on a much smoother path, and their unit needed people that capable. frёewebηovel.cѳm

But it was too dangerous.

The list of attendees for the training was reviewed and deliberated over again and again.

Tang Yuanxiao wasn’t on that list at all.

Even before the divorce, he hadn’t been under consideration, let alone now that he was divorced.

Although enrollment was voluntary, and in theory, anyone who passed the assessment and insisted on going could go, the leadership couldn’t just let that happen. They had to consider every angle.

"Don’t you know your own situation? You can’t go."

The supervisor said earnestly, "You’re still young. Working this hard is already enough."

’He can’t just throw his life away and be a daredevil all the time!’

"Boss, don’t worry. Since I’m signing up, I know what I’m getting into. Nothing will happen to me. Don’t you trust me?"

The profound calm in Tang Yuanxiao’s eyes told the supervisor that this wasn’t an impulsive decision.

"I trust your abilities, but what if..."

"There is no ’what if,’ Boss. Don’t worry. I won’t let anything happen to me."

He couldn’t afford for anything to happen. He didn’t have the right.

The ambition and certainty in Tang Yuanxiao’s gaze left the supervisor stunned for a moment.

’This divorce really has affected him deeply.’

"Are you doing this because of Su Li? Did she provoke you into this?" The supervisor couldn’t help but think so.

Tang Yuanxiao shook his head. "Yes and no. I just feel... I have to do this. I must do this."

It was as if he had suddenly woken up, realizing he couldn’t afford to be complacent. He had always worked hard, but there had been no sense of urgency, always a feeling that things were "good enough."

But this time, he had been jolted awake.

’If I want to advance, I have to work harder.’

He was just an ordinary person. To stand out in a world where everyone was striving, he had to fight even harder.

Wu Sheng was only about two years older than him, but their statuses were worlds apart.

Why? Claiming that Wu Sheng was smarter, more capable, or had more resources was just self-deception. It was because Wu Sheng worked harder.

Wu Sheng had gone through that training program years ago! Wu Sheng pushed himself harder and worked more relentlessly. What right did he have to make excuses?

He couldn’t afford not to give it his all. He had to.

This world was fair. You reaped what you sowed.

Wu Sheng was already far ahead of him. And Su Li, through her own efforts, was steadily reaching a position he hadn’t dared to imagine for himself.

He couldn’t fall too far behind. He had to move forward, to reach a place where he would be worthy of Su Li, where he wouldn’t even have the right to compete fairly with Wu Sheng.

"Tang Yuanxiao, is this a decision you’ve made after thinking about your child and your elderly mother?"

The supervisor asked after a long moment of silence. freewёbnoνel.com

Tang Yuanxiao nodded heavily. "Yes, Boss."

’I will definitely return safely.’

The supervisor waved his hand. "I understand. You can go for now."

’It’s frustrating when someone you value lacks ambition, but it’s a whole other kind of trouble when they’re too ambitious.’

’In the end, he was just provoked! And to top it off, his promotion is up in the air...’

The supervisor stood up, left his office to smoke a cigarette and calm down. On his way back, he passed the office next door and happened to overhear people talking about a "military training pilot program."

He stood there listening for a moment, a glint in his eye, before turning and entering that office.

Less than half an hour after leaving the supervisor’s office, Tang Yuanxiao was called back.

"Boss?" Tang Yuanxiao thought the supervisor had forgotten to tell him something, but to his surprise, the man was just beaming at him from the moment he walked in.

"Ah, Tang Yuanxiao, if you manage to win your wife back, you’ll have to treat me to a matchmaker’s dinner."

Tang Yuanxiao was completely baffled. "Boss?"

"It’s a deal." And with that, the ultimate wingman logged on. The supervisor chuckled with a boyish grin. "You just said you plan to win your wife back, right?"

Tang Yuanxiao nodded.

"How do you plan to do that? You’re here at the unit, and your wife is in the Imperial City. You can’t even see her. You might have the will, but you don’t have the way. How are you going to win her back?"

That was indeed a huge problem.

The supervisor’s words made Tang Yuanxiao freeze. He could only say, "I’ll find a chance eventually."

The supervisor waved a dismissive hand. "I knew you’d say that. You can wait for an opportunity, but an opportunity won’t wait for you."

He huffed. "Is Huaguo Communication University just some ordinary school? It’s a gathering place for the most outstanding people in the country. Su Li is surrounded by a crowd of exceptional men, and you’re still waiting for an opportunity!"

"That girl, Su Li, is beautiful and capable. Who knows how many talented young men she’ll attract... It’ll probably be several times tougher than when I was pursuing your Aunt Chang. What are you going to use to stand out? Your looks?"

Tang Yuanxiao was speechless. ’Boss, please, stop twisting the knife!’

The supervisor put on the air of a seasoned veteran. "Kid, you’re still too green. Waiting for an opportunity? If there’s no opportunity, you have to create one."

Tang Yuanxiao was speechless again. ’Boss, please, not one blow after another!’

"Alright, enough picking on you. I feel sorry for you, so I’ll give you a hand."

The supervisor took out a piece of paper and placed it in front of Tang Yuanxiao. "Learn from this for the future."

Tang Yuanxiao looked at it, puzzled, then his eyes shot wide open. "Boss!"

"Surprised? Happy? This is me creating an opportunity for you. Take advantage of this period when you have no assignments and go work hard."

The supervisor was truly going to great lengths, just hoping that the agitated Tang Yuanxiao could calm down a bit.

The supervisor was just marveling at his own cleverness when he was startled the next second.

Tang Yuanxiao, who had been so worked up he could barely get a word out, suddenly slammed his hand on the supervisor’s desk in a burst of excitement, completely overcome.

"Boss, thank you."

The supervisor waved his hand dismissively. "Get out, get out."

Tang Yuanxiao obediently "got out," carefully studying the paper all the way, looking incredibly satisfied with the words written on it.
